hi everyone, i live in hawaii and although we have endless ocean there is a serious lack in the secondhand hobie market. after reading about all the different makes models etc i have determined that an h18 is a good fit but i cant find one!!! does anyone have some advice (other than craigslist) on how to do this? thanks,

1. If you're on Oahu go to Kaneohe and put notes on the 18's you see on the beach asking if they want to sell.
2. Make friends with Hobie dealers on the mainland to keep an eye out for you. Shipping costs $$, but. . .
3. Post here.
